Skip to content

Latest commit

 

History

History
74 lines (55 loc) · 4.36 KB

README.md

File metadata and controls

74 lines (55 loc) · 4.36 KB

CustomMappings

(vault().customMappings())

Overview

Available Operations

  • list - List custom mappings

list

This endpoint returns a list of custom mappings.

Example Usage

package hello.world;

import com.apideck.unify.Apideck;
import com.apideck.unify.models.errors.BadRequestResponse;
import com.apideck.unify.models.errors.NotFoundResponse;
import com.apideck.unify.models.errors.PaymentRequiredResponse;
import com.apideck.unify.models.errors.UnauthorizedResponse;
import com.apideck.unify.models.errors.UnprocessableResponse;
import com.apideck.unify.models.operations.VaultCustomMappingsAllResponse;
import java.lang.Exception;

public class Application {

    public static void main(String[] args) throws BadRequestResponse, UnauthorizedResponse, PaymentRequiredResponse, NotFoundResponse, UnprocessableResponse, Exception {

        Apideck sdk = Apideck.builder()
                .apiKey("<YOUR_BEARER_TOKEN_HERE>")
                .consumerId("test-consumer")
                .appId("dSBdXd2H6Mqwfg0atXHXYcysLJE9qyn1VwBtXHX")
            .build();

        VaultCustomMappingsAllResponse res = sdk.vault().customMappings().list()
                .consumerId("test-consumer")
                .appId("dSBdXd2H6Mqwfg0atXHXYcysLJE9qyn1VwBtXHX")
                .unifiedApi("crm")
                .serviceId("pipedrive")
                .call();

        if (res.getCustomMappingsResponse().isPresent()) {
            // handle response
        }
    }
}

Parameters

Parameter Type Required Description Example
consumerId Optional<String> ID of the consumer which you want to get or push data from test-consumer
appId Optional<String> The ID of your Unify application dSBdXd2H6Mqwfg0atXHXYcysLJE9qyn1VwBtXHX
unifiedApi String ✔️ Unified API crm
serviceId String ✔️ Service ID of the resource to return pipedrive

Response

VaultCustomMappingsAllResponse

Errors

Error Type Status Code Content Type
models/errors/BadRequestResponse 400 application/json
models/errors/UnauthorizedResponse 401 application/json
models/errors/PaymentRequiredResponse 402 application/json
models/errors/NotFoundResponse 404 application/json
models/errors/UnprocessableResponse 422 application/json
models/errors/APIException 4XX, 5XX */*